Moving beyond logos, think about packaging design. On a shelf, you have mere seconds to communicate what a product is and why someone should pick it up. A display font like Blockton can dominate the front of a package, clearly stating the product name or a key benefit like "ORGANIC" or "PREMIUM." Its thick strokes cut cleanly for vinyl stickers and print with precision on labels, avoiding the blurriness that can plague more intricate typefaces. This clarity is crucial for both shelf appeal and for conveying essential information quickly.

Maximizing Readability and Audience Connection
While style is important, a font must ultimately serve communication. Blockton’s design philosophy prioritizes function alongside form. The generous x-height and open counters—the negative space inside letters like ‘e’ and ‘a’—ensure that words remain legible even at a glance. This is critical for applications like signage, where people may be viewing from a distance or in motion, and for web design, where text must be easily scannable on screens of all sizes.
Readability directly impacts audience engagement. If your message is difficult to read, people will simply move on. By choosing a typeface that is both striking and clear, you remove a potential barrier between your content and your audience. This is especially important for calls to action, key headlines, and any text that carries your core message. A bold display font should amplify your message, not obscure it, and Blockton’s balanced letterforms are designed with this principle in mind.
When integrating a new font into your workflow, always test it in context. How does it look on your actual website? Does it pair well with the body font you’ve already chosen? Print a sample of your packaging design to check the clarity. View your social media graphic on a phone screen to ensure the headline is still powerful. This hands-on testing is the best way to ensure a font will meet the practical demands of your specific projects and help you achieve the professional presentation you’re aiming for.
